Abstract: | The authors state that improvement of performance measurement for working-capital management lies in the recognition of the operating roots of the financial results. Understanding of four key working-capital business processes, and the value propositions they can affect, enables both root-cause analysis of problems and the ability to test the consequences of proposed corrective actions. Value paths and measure sets from the Measure Network enable an understanding of key working-capital relationships. The authors also state that using these measurement tools gives managers a clearer understanding of the benefit and cost trade-offs for working capital and, thereby, supports better decision making and improved corporate performance. |
